Q: Why does my new NVMe SSD show performance degradation or inconsistent behavior when connected through a PCIe adapter mobile rack?
A: High-speed PCIe devices, such as NVMe SSDs, require precise and stable signal integrity to operate correctly. If your NVMe SSD is connected via a PCIe adapter mobile rack that is inserted into a CPU-connected PCIe slot far from the CPU, the longer motherboard traces can increase the risk of signal degradation. This degradation can cause your NVMe SSD to experience performance drops, instability, or inconsistent behavior.
To ensure optimal performance, it is strongly recommended to install the PCIe adapter mobile rack into a PCIe slot closest to the CPU. Doing so minimizes the physical distance for signal transmission, significantly reducing the potential for signal degradation and ensuring stable, consistent performance and expected transfer speeds.
Q: The system does not detect the E1.S SSD I installed in the ICY DOCK enclosure. What should I do?
A: Since the motherboard and operating system may not support hot-swapping, if their compatibility has not been confirmed, we highly recommend powering off the device/system before inserting or removing an E1.S SSD.
If the system is still unable to detect the drive after installation, please follow the steps below to manually scan for new hardware:
Windows 11 / Windows 10 / Windows 8 – In the search box on the taskbar, type device manager, and click it from the menu. Once the device manager window pops up, right-click on the disk drive icon, and click scan for hardware changes.
Windows 7 – Right-click on the computer icon on the desktop, select properties, click device manager, right-click on the disk drive icon and then click scan for hardware changes.
